FindReact(dom:Element, traverseUp:number = 0):React.Component|React.PureComponent{
// taken from https://stackoverflow.com/questions/29321742/react-getting-a-component-from-a-dom-element-for-debugging#39165137
const key = Object.keys(dom).find(key=>key.startsWith("__reactInternalInstance$"));
const domFiber = dom[key];
if (domFiber == null) return null;
// react <16
if (domFiber._currentElement) {
let compFiber = domFiber._currentElement._owner;
for (let i = 0; i < traverseUp; i++) {
compFiber = compFiber._currentElement._owner;
}
return compFiber._instance;
}
// react 16+
const GetCompFiber = fiber=>{
//return fiber._debugOwner; // this also works, but is __DEV__ only
let parentFiber = fiber.return;
while (typeof parentFiber.type == "string") {
parentFiber = parentFiber.return;
}
return parentFiber;
};
let compFiber = GetCompFiber(domFiber);
for (let i = 0; i < traverseUp; i++) {
compFiber = GetCompFiber(compFiber);
}
return compFiber.stateNode;
}
